5 Signs Revealing That It's Time for a New Roof

September 30, 2022

Your roof is the first line of protection, so it's essential to know when it's time for a replacement. Many homeowners do not even think about their roofs until there is a severe problem they can not overlook. By then, it might be too late. Let's get acquainted with the signs that it is time to replace your roof. If you are experiencing any of these problems, please call a professional immediately!

1. Damaged Chimney Flashing

It is the metal strip that seals the gap between the chimney and the roof. It can corrode or crack over time. If this happens, water can enter your home, causing serious damage. Call a professional immediately if you notice any problems with the chimney flashing. Having regular inspections of the chimney is also essential to catch any problems before they turn serious.


2. Out of Shape Shingles

The most common sign to replace an old roof is if the shingles are starting to curl or buckle. If they are no longer lying flat, they have reached the end of their lifespan and need to be replaced. When shingles are not in good condition, they can cause leaks and other damage, no longer providing any protection to the home. It is imperative to catch this early and not wait until it's too late.


3. Mildew and Moss Development

If you start to see green spots on the roof, moss or mildew will start to grow. It points to a significant problem, such as leaks or poor drainage. If you see moss or mold, it's best to have a professional inspect your roof to see if there is a requirement for a new one. Moss and mildew are not only unsightly, but they can also damage the roof and bring moisture into your home.


4. Rotting and Leaking Roof Sheathing

Roof sheathing is the layer of plywood or OSB boards onto which the shingles are nailed. If this layer is rotting or leaking, it's a sure sign that the roof needs to be replaced. The rotting and leakage can be caused by several things, including poor ventilation, ice dams, or faulty shingles. If you witness these signs, it's best to call a roofing professional to take a look.


5. Old Roofing

When the roof is 15+ years old, it's probably time for a replacement. The average asphalt shingle roof lasts between 20 and 25 years, so if the roof is approaching or has surpassed that age, it's time to start thinking about a replacement. Of course, a roof's lifespan depends on a number of factors, such as the quality of the materials used, the installation, the climate, and how well the roof has been maintained. 


6. High Energy Bills

Are you getting high energy bills lately? If you are witnessing a constant increase in energy bills, your roof could be the reason behind it. As the roof ages, it becomes less energy-efficient, and the HVAC system has to work harder to maintain a comfortable temperature. It can lead to hiking up your energy bills. You can save money on energy bills by replacing the old roof with a new, energy-efficient one.
